> I recently rented "Daydream Believers: The Monkees Story" via Netflix
> and found it unwatchable, save one redeeming feature. Firstly, it's not
> a documentary, it's a low-budget movie with actors playing the Monkees
> and everyone else involved. I know, I should have read the blurb and the
> reviews much more carefully. On the other hand, in the "special
> features" section you'll find 3 long and very interesting on-camera
> interviews with Mickey, Davy and Peter (each of them alone, facing one
> camera with an off-camera, unheard interviewer) from *2001*. They were
> well worth watching! I just finished the book "Monkeemania: The True
> Story of the Monkees" and found that 95% of the information in the book
> matched up almost perfectly with the words that came out of their
> mouths in the DVD interviews. That was refreshing. Their stories fairly
> well matched up with each other as well. Good stuff! Just don't expect
> anything much from the "movie" if you're already fairly well versed in
> the Monkee story.
>
> Can anyone recommend anything on DVD that might resemble what I was
> originally hoping to find, i.e. a well done comprehensive documentary
> on the whole Monkees story, from first tv auditions through "Head"?
